Output c518eea21f7350de935033f4d24375980a56348bb7fc2a1f918d3ee394d08264:1

value
2851440
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 796c38b329d50b99cb0dfd54360cda0f552c8348 OP_EQUALVERIFY OP_CHECKSIG
address
1C52QaBCzCFvJEHswuomS8uycFqY9de7RU
transaction
c518eea21f7350de935033f4d24375980a56348bb7fc2a1f918d3ee394d08264
confirmations
592957
spent
true